2025 Compare Cities Politics & Voting:
Gig Harbor, WA vs Woodburn, OR
Change Cities
Highlights
- Registered voters in Woodburn are 11.9% less likely to be registered as Democrats than registered voters in Gig Harbor.
- Registered voters in Gig Harbor, are 0.2% less likely to be registered as Democrats, than in the rest of the United States.
